Royal School of Needlework-- 2015 Courses

Saturday, March 6, 2010

Second Hint


This impressive building is across the street from the marina that anchors the street where all the restaurants are located on this island. Since it is Winter, there are no boats in the marina.
Posted by Picasa

1 comment:

Margaret said...

Denise has figured this out. The island is Jamestown Island, located between the Narragansett Verrazano Bridge and the Pell Bridge to Newport, Rhode Island, shown in a previous photo. The street where this building is located is at the foot of Narragansett Avenue in Jamestown.